Putting it into perspective: Megaupload had 25 petabytes of data residing on more than 1,000 servers. One petabyte of data, according to Gizmodo, equals 13.3 years of high definition television content. If our math is correct, that’s 332.5 years worth of HDTV content stored on Megaupload’s servers.
